This program of Stravinsky ballets features the Carnegie Hall debut of a rising-star conductor: Klaus Mäkelä, recently named the next music director of Amsterdam’s Concertgebouw. The Firebird is a colorful showpiece that catapulted Stravinsky to international fame, and Mäkelä’s reading of it has been praised as “organic … each scene flowing seamlessly into the next” (Chicago Classical Review). The Rite of Spring is a revolutionary work, a true milestone that continues to seize and thrill audiences more than a century after its famously riotous Parisian debut.
